Neural defects in Jarcho-Levin syndrome.

Summary
Jarcho-Levin syndrome, a rare genetic disorder, can involve neural defects. Neuropathologic findings in two patients revealed spinal cord abnormalities, suggesting a link between Jarcho-Levin syndrome and neurological issues.

Background:
- Jarcho-Levin syndrome is a rare genetic disorder characterized by skeletal malformations.
- Previous understanding of Jarcho-Levin syndrome primarily focused on skeletal and visceral abnormalities.
- The neurological involvement in Jarcho-Levin syndrome has not been extensively studied.
Observation:
- Neuropathologic examination was performed on two autopsied patients diagnosed with Jarcho-Levin syndrome.
- One patient showed no significant neuropathologic changes in the brain, spinal cord, or nerve roots.
- The second patient exhibited diastematomyelia, a congenital condition involving the splitting of the spinal cord, in the thoracolumbar region.
Findings:
- The presence of spinal cord abnormalities in one patient, alongside literature reports of similar cases, suggests a potential neurological component to Jarcho-Levin syndrome.
- Diastematomyelia represents a specific type of neural tube defect that may be associated with Jarcho-Levin syndrome.
- These findings indicate that neural defects can be a feature of Jarcho-Levin syndrome.
Implications:
- The study highlights the importance of considering neurological assessments in patients with Jarcho-Levin syndrome.
- Identifying neural defects expands the spectrum of Jarcho-Levin syndrome manifestations.
- Further research is warranted to elucidate the mechanisms underlying neural abnormalities in Jarcho-Levin syndrome and their clinical significance.
